With just a few days remaining in the campaign, the French have finally captured Ratisbon, one of their two objectives. But to replicate Napoleon's historical success, our French players would somehow need to also affect the capture of Landshut with only four days to go. The entire Austrian army stands in their way on the road to Landshut, setting the table for what should be the campaign's ultimate showdown. When and where will the epic battle happen?
APRIL 23, Turn 9
Weather Report: Clear skies
Journal: Detaching a force to garrison Ratisbon, the French proceeded to march south via the Eggmuhl road. The advance was expertly hampered by effective use of Austrian cavalry and recon elements, slowing Napoleon's columns. Archduke Charles seemed content with his chosen ground for the main army and calmly waited for the enemy to come to him.
